Top 1 Best Value Associate Degree Colleges for Composite Materials Technology in Maine
Out of the 1 schools in the Best Value Composite Materials Technology Schools for an Associate in Maine that were part of this year’s ranking, Southern Maine Community College landed the #1 spot on the list. SMCC is a medium-sized public school situated in South Portland, Maine. It awarded 2 associates’s composite materials technology degrees in 2019-2020.
As a testament to the quality of education offered at SMCC, the school also landed the #1 spot in our “Best Composite Materials Technology Associate Degree Schools in Maine” ranking. The yearly cost to attend SMCC is $10,647 for Maine Associate Degree Composite Materials Technology students.
